The Bessemer process was the first method for making steel cheaply and in large quantities, developed during the early 1850s. It was named after British engineer Henry Bessemer (1813 – 1898), who invented the process. The process was also developed independently in the United States by William Kelly … Webb23 sep. 2024 · On 24 August 1856 Bessemer first described the process to a meeting of the British Association in Cheltenham which he titled “The Manufacture of Iron Without Fuel.” It was published in full in The Times. WebbImportance. The Bessemer process revolutionized steel manufacture by decreasing its cost, from £40 per long ton to £6–7 per long ton, along with greatly increasing the scale and speed of production of this vital raw material. The process also decreased the labor requirements for steel-making. Prior to its introduction, steel was far too ...
